91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

Rust語言應用有何獨特優勢

小樊
82
2024-10-26 16:44:28
欄目: 編程語言

Rust語言因其獨特的優勢,在系統編程、網絡編程、并發編程等領域得到了廣泛應用。以下是Rust語言應用的一些獨特優勢:

  • 內存安全:Rust通過其所有權系統和借用檢查器,在編譯時就能發現并預防大多數內存相關的錯誤,如空指針引用、數據競爭等,從而避免了C/C++等語言中常見的內存泄漏和段錯誤等問題。
  • 高性能:Rust沒有垃圾回收機制,所有資源的分配和釋放都由編譯器進行精確控制,這使得Rust的運行效率可以媲美C/C++。
  • 并發性:Rust對并發編程提供了強大的支持,它通過線程安全機制和消息傳遞機制,可以方便地編寫高效、安全的并發程序。
  • 零成本抽象:Rust允許開發者使用高級抽象,如枚舉、結構體、泛型等,這些抽象不會引入運行時性能開銷。
  • 跨平臺支持:Rust支持多種平臺,包括Windows、macOS、Linux等,還可以編譯為WebAssembly,使得代碼可以在瀏覽器中運行。
  • 活躍的社區和豐富的生態系統:Rust有一個非常活躍的開發者社區,提供了大量的資源和支持,使得開發者可以很容易地找到幫助和解決方案。

Rust語言通過其內存安全、高性能、并發性、零成本抽象、跨平臺支持以及活躍的社區和豐富的生態系統,為開發者提供了一種高效、可靠且靈活的編程選擇。

0
武强县| 东兴市| 乌苏市| 闸北区| 进贤县| 东明县| 杭锦后旗| 永城市| 吴川市| 望奎县| 镇原县| 咸阳市| 攀枝花市| 新化县| 龙胜| 乌拉特后旗| 湛江市| 泽普县| 柘城县| 双柏县| 泊头市| 遂溪县| 枝江市| 光山县| 东方市| 中宁县| 紫云| 灵丘县| 兴隆县| 峡江县| 龙海市| 临邑县| 成武县| 兴化市| 大同县| 卢龙县| 静安区| 琼结县| 南昌县| 会宁县| 广元市|